Definition of Gram-force Meter

A gram-force meter (gf·m) is a unit of work or energy in the gravitational metric system. It is defined as the work done by a force of one gram-force acting over a distance of one meter. In other words, when a one gram-force is applied to move an object through a one meter distance, the energy expended in doing so is one gram-force meter. This measurement is commonly used in physics and engineering to quantify the work performed or energy transferred in a system.

Definition of Calorie

A calorie is a unit of energy commonly used to quantify the amount of energy food provides to the human body. It is defined as the amount of heat required to raise the temperature of one gram of water by one degree Celsius. Dieticians and nutritionists often use the calorie as a measure to recommend daily energy intake for maintaining, losing, or gaining weight. The calorie is also used in various fields such as chemistry and physics to express energy content in different contexts.
